How long do brake pads usually last?

On average, brake pads last between 25,000 and 60,000 miles. That range is wide because brake wear depends heavily on how and where you drive.

For example:

  • Stop-start driving through Shaftesbury or Blandford town centres can increase wear
  • Rural Dorset roads with hills can put extra demand on braking
  • Heavier vehicles often wear pads more quickly
  • Smooth, steady driving tends to extend brake life

There isn’t a single mileage rule that fits everyone, which is why regular checks matter.


Signs your brake pads may need replacing

Brake pads usually give warning before they become unsafe.

Common signs include:

  • Squealing or screeching when braking
  • Grinding sounds
  • A vibrating brake pedal
  • Longer stopping distances
  • A brake warning light

If you notice any of these while driving around Shaftesbury, Blandford or further afield, it’s best to have the brakes checked. Leaving it too long can lead to brake disc damage, which increases repair costs.


Why replacing them at the right time saves money

Brake pads are designed to wear out first. They protect the more expensive parts of the braking system.

If they’re replaced at the right time, the rest of the system remains in good condition. If they’re left too long, metal can grind against metal and damage the discs.

Do front and rear brake pads wear the same?

Usually not.

On most vehicles, the front brake pads wear faster because they handle the majority of the braking force. Rear pads may last longer but still need regular inspection.

Does driving style really make a difference?

Yes, it does.

Harsh braking, riding the brakes downhill or leaving braking too late in traffic all increase wear. Anticipating traffic and braking smoothly reduces strain and helps pads last longer.
